1

PHP POST リクエストを Apache サーバーに送信している間、リクエストはサーバーによってブロックされます。禁止エラーが発生しています。これは、一部の要求に対して非常に具体的です。リクエストでは、html データを送信し、html データを MYSQL データベースに保存しています。UNIX オペレーティング システムを使用しています。

次のような文を保存しようとして process = runtime.exec(""); います。上記の文を送信しています。禁止されたエラーが発生しています。それ以外の場合は、成功の応答が返されます。

4

1 に答える 1

0

あなたのサーバーの設定では、いくつかの URL パラメータ値が禁止されていると思います。ここで見つけることができる理由を説明する比較例 (Struts の場合): https://www.sec-consult.com/files/20120104-0_Apache_Struts2_Multiple_Critical_Vulnerabilities.txt

何らかのエンコーディングでだまそうとするか (これが機能するとは思えません)、「.exec(」という単語を無害なものに置き換えることができます。

于 2012-10-09T18:38:47.300 に答える